首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

自定义KERAS模型的可训练参数

是指模型中可以通过反向传播算法进行优化的参数。在KERAS中,可以通过继承tf.keras.layers.Layer类来自定义模型,然后定义模型的可训练参数。

一般而言,可训练参数主要包括权重(weights)和偏置(biases)。权重是用来调整输入数据的影响力,使模型能够更好地适应训练数据;而偏置是用来调整模型输出的基准值,从而使模型能够更好地适应不同的数据。

自定义KERAS模型的可训练参数可以通过以下步骤实现:

  1. 继承tf.keras.layers.Layer类并重写__init__方法,用于初始化模型的参数。在__init__方法中,可以使用self.add_weight方法创建可训练参数,并设置其初始值、形状等属性。
  2. 继承tf.keras.layers.Layer类并重写__init__方法,用于初始化模型的参数。在__init__方法中,可以使用self.add_weight方法创建可训练参数,并设置其初始值、形状等属性。
  3. 重写call方法,用于定义模型的前向传播过程。在call方法中,可以使用之前定义的可训练参数进行计算。
  4. 重写call方法,用于定义模型的前向传播过程。在call方法中,可以使用之前定义的可训练参数进行计算。

通过以上步骤,我们就可以自定义一个具有可训练参数的KERAS模型。在训练过程中,模型会根据损失函数的反向传播结果自动调整可训练参数的值,从而不断优化模型的性能。

在实际应用中,自定义KERAS模型的可训练参数可以用于解决各种复杂的机器学习和深度学习任务,例如图像分类、目标检测、语音识别等。通过调整可训练参数的值,模型可以适应不同类型的数据,并提高预测的准确性。

腾讯云提供的相关产品和产品介绍链接地址:

  • 腾讯云机器学习平台:提供丰富的机器学习和深度学习服务,包括模型训练、推理、部署等功能,可用于自定义KERAS模型的训练和部署。
  • 腾讯云AI开放平台:提供多种人工智能能力和算法模型,可用于自定义KERAS模型的拓展和优化。

需要注意的是,以上只是腾讯云提供的部分相关产品和介绍链接,其他云计算品牌商也提供类似的机器学习和人工智能服务,具体选择可根据需求和实际情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

15分33秒

04-Stable Diffusion的训练与部署-19-dreambooth训练参数的设置

1分33秒

04-Stable Diffusion的训练与部署-28-预训练模型的获取方式

27分30秒

使用huggingface预训练模型解70%的nlp问题

24.1K
9分36秒

04-Stable Diffusion的训练与部署-25-lora训练参数设置

5分43秒

32.分析可重入锁使用的Redis数据模型

2分9秒

04-Stable Diffusion的训练与部署-29-模型预测介绍

4分35秒

04-Stable Diffusion的训练与部署-21-dreambooth模型权重保存

7分55秒

04-Stable Diffusion的训练与部署-16-dreambooth变量设置和模型转换

8分38秒

day27_IO流与网络编程/10-尚硅谷-Java语言高级-自定义类可序列化的其它要求

8分38秒

day27_IO流与网络编程/10-尚硅谷-Java语言高级-自定义类可序列化的其它要求

8分38秒

day27_IO流与网络编程/10-尚硅谷-Java语言高级-自定义类可序列化的其它要求

1时8分

第 2 章 监督学习:线性模型(2)

领券